Smoflipid

Payments companies reported to CMS as associated with Smoflipid. "Associated with" is CMS's wording: it links a payment to a product without saying the money was spent on it.

$300Kassociated payments (2023-2025)
392clinicians with associated payments
1company reporting

By year

2023 $85K
2024 $139K
2025 $76K

Payments reported as associated with Smoflipid, per program year, as reported to CMS.
